Summary
Cryptococcal meningitis can cause reversible hearing loss. This case shows profound hearing loss as the first sign of cryptococcal meningitis in a young woman with AIDS.
Area of Science:
- Neurology
- Infectious Diseases
- Otolaryngology
Background:
- Cryptococcal meningitis is an infection of the central nervous system.
- Sensorineural hearing loss is a known complication.
- Typical symptoms include fever, headache, and neck stiffness.
Purpose of the Study:
- To report a case of cryptococcal meningitis presenting initially with profound hearing loss.
- To highlight an atypical presentation of this infection.
Main Methods:
- Case report.
Main Results:
- A young woman presented with acute, profound, bilateral sensorineural hearing loss.
- This was the initial symptom of cryptococcal meningitis.
- She was subsequently diagnosed with acquired immunodeficiency syndrome (AIDS).
Conclusions:
- Acute hearing loss can be the primary presenting symptom of cryptococcal meningitis.
- This presentation is particularly relevant in patients with underlying immunocompromise, such as AIDS.

Auditory Pathway
6.2K
Auditory pathways constitute the complex neural circuits responsible for transmitting and interpreting auditory information from the peripheral auditory system to the brain. Sound waves are initially captured by the outer ear, funneled through the ear canal, and reach the tympanic membrane (eardrum). These vibrations are transmitted via the middle ear's ossicles to the inner ear's cochlea.

Hearing
54.8K
When we hear a sound, our nervous system is detecting sound waves—pressure waves of mechanical energy traveling through a medium. The frequency of the wave is perceived as pitch, while the amplitude is perceived as loudness.
